Gradual Release of Responsibility: A Teacher's Guide
TL;DR
The Gradual Release of Responsibility (GRR) model shifts learning from teacher to student in four phases: I Do (modeling), We Do (guided practice), You Do Together (collaborative work), and You Do (independent practice). Used well, it builds real student independence instead of leaving learners to sink or swim.
Most teachers know the frustration. You explain a concept clearly, students nod along, then hand back work that shows they never really understood it. The problem often isn't the lesson content. It's the jump from teacher explanation straight to independent work, with nothing in between.
The Gradual Release of Responsibility (GRR) model was designed to fix exactly this. First described by P. David Pearson and Margaret Gallagher in 1983, and later expanded by Douglas Fisher and Nancy Frey, GRR gives teachers a clear sequence for handing off cognitive work to students. Instead of "I taught it, they should know it," GRR treats independence as something you deliberately build.
The Four Phases of Gradual Release
GRR is often summed up as "I do, we do, you do," but Fisher and Frey argue that a fourth step, collaborative learning, is what makes it work in real classrooms. Here's what each phase looks like.
1. Focused Instruction: "I Do"
This is the modeling phase. You demonstrate the skill or strategy out loud, showing not just the steps but your thinking. If you're teaching how to analyze a primary source, you narrate what you notice, what confuses you, and how you sort it out. The goal is to make expert thinking visible.
Key move: think aloud. Don't just perform the task, explain your reasoning as you go. This phase should be short and focused. Fisher and Frey suggest around 10 to 15 minutes.
2. Guided Instruction: "We Do"
Now you and students work through a similar problem together. You prompt, they contribute. You correct misconceptions in real time. This is where teachers gather crucial evidence about who is following and who is lost.
Key move: ask questions that require reasoning, not one-word answers. "What should we look for first? Why does that matter?" Small group settings work better than whole class for this phase, because you can hear more student thinking.
3. Collaborative Learning: "You Do Together"
Students work with peers on a related task. They talk through their process, debate approaches, and consolidate understanding by explaining ideas to each other. This is the phase most GRR shortcuts skip, and it's the one that builds the most durable learning.
Key move: give the group a task that genuinely requires everyone. Vague group work leaves one student doing all the work. A well-designed collaborative task assigns roles or requires multiple perspectives.
4. Independent Learning: "You Do"
Now students apply the skill alone. This might be homework, a quiz, a written response, or a project step. Because they moved through modeling, guided practice, and peer collaboration first, they're actually ready. Independent work becomes a chance to demonstrate mastery, not a guessing game.
Why GRR Works: The Research Base
GRR isn't just a lesson template. It pulls together several strands of cognitive and educational research.
Cognitive load theory. John Sweller's work shows that novices benefit hugely from worked examples and modeling before independent practice. Jumping to independent work overwhelms working memory and produces frustration, not learning.
Vygotsky's zone of proximal development. The ZPD is the space where students can succeed with support but not alone. Guided and collaborative phases live inside the ZPD, moving students toward independence.
Bandura's social learning theory. Students learn a great deal by observing and imitating skilled performance. The "I do" phase leverages this directly.
A 2014 study by Fisher and Frey found that classrooms using structured GRR showed stronger student achievement across subjects, particularly in literacy, compared to classrooms that jumped from lecture to independent seatwork.
Common Mistakes to Avoid
GRR looks simple on paper. In practice, teachers often stumble in predictable ways.
- Spending too long on "I do." If modeling stretches past 15 minutes, you've lost most students. Keep it tight and focused on the exact skill.
- Skipping "you do together." This is the most cut phase because it feels less efficient. It's actually the phase where consolidation happens.
- Rushing to independent work. If students bomb the independent task, the answer usually isn't more homework. It's a longer guided or collaborative phase.
- Using GRR mechanically. Phases don't have to be equal length or happen in one lesson. A complex skill might spread across a week.
- Forgetting formative assessment. Each phase should give you evidence about whether students are ready to move on. Use it.
What GRR Looks Like in Different Subjects
| Subject | Sample GRR Cycle |
|---|---|
| English | Model close reading of a paragraph, guide analysis of the next paragraph together, small groups annotate the next section, students annotate independently. |
| Math | Solve a problem while thinking aloud, work through a similar problem with student input, groups solve a variation together, students solve independently. |
| Science | Model how to design a controlled experiment, plan one together as a class, small groups design experiments for related questions, students write independent lab reports. |
| History | Model sourcing a primary document, source another document with class input, groups source a set of documents, students write an independent document-based response. |

A Simple GRR Planning Template
When planning a lesson or unit, ask yourself these questions.
- What exact skill or strategy am I teaching? Be specific.
- How will I model it out loud so students see the thinking, not just the answer?
- What guided task will let me see who understands and who doesn't?
- What collaborative task requires all group members to contribute?
- What independent task will show me whether students can transfer the skill?
- How will I check for understanding at each phase before moving on?

Frequently Asked Questions
Does the Gradual Release of Responsibility have to happen in one lesson? No. Complex skills often spread the four phases across several lessons or a full week. What matters is the sequence, not the timing.
What's the difference between GRR and scaffolding? Scaffolding is any temporary support you give a student. GRR is a specific framework that structures how you remove that scaffolding over time, moving students toward independence.
Can I use GRR with younger students? Yes. GRR works in every grade level, though phases may be shorter and more concrete for younger learners. The core sequence, modeling then guided practice then collaboration then independent work, applies at any age.
